How our sorting works

The order in which job vacancies are displayed is determined by a composite score based on the following factors:

  • Keyword Relevance: How well your search terms match the vacancy details. We prioritize matches found in the job title, followed by job requirements, location names, and educational levels. Matches within general employer information or the organization's name carry a lower weight.
  • Commercial Prioritization (Premium Jobs): Vacancies paid for by employers ('Premium' or 'Sponsored') receive a ranking boost and will appear higher in the search results.
  • Recency (Date Relevance): Newer vacancies are prioritized. The relevance score of a vacancy is reduced by half once the posting is older than 30 days.
  • Proximity (Distance Relevance): Vacancies located closer to your search location are ranked higher. For vacancies located more than 30 km from the search center, the relevance score is halved.
The final ranking is established by multiplying all these individual factors to calculate the total relevance score.

    Job Title: Children's Support Worker
    Location: Brighton
    Salary: £17.00 - £19.00 per hour

    About the Role:
    We are currently seeking dedicated and compassionate Children's Support Workers to join our team in Brighton and surrounding areas. This rewarding role involves supporting children and young people with a range of needs, helping them to achieve positive outcomes and live fulfilling lives in a safe and nurturing environment.

    Key Responsibilities:

    Provide high-quality care and support to children and young people
    Promote emotional well-being, independence, and personal development
    Support with daily routines, including education, activities, and appointments
    Build positive, trusting relationships with service users
    Maintain accurate records and follow care plans
    Work collaboratively with families, social workers, and other professionalsRequirements:

    Minimum of 6 months' experience working with children or young people in the UK
    Full UK driving licence and access to a vehicle (essential)
    Strong communication and interpersonal skills
    Ability to remain calm and professional in challenging situations
    Flexibility to work shifts, including evenings and weekendsDesirable (but not essential):

    Restraint training (e.g. MAPA, CPI, or equivalent)
    Relevant qualifications in Health & Social Care or ChildcareWhat We Offer:

    Competitive hourly rate of £17.00 - £19.00
    Ongoing training and professional development opportunities
    Supportive team environment
    Flexible working patternsIf you are passionate about making a difference in the lives of children and young people, we would love to hear from you.
